Скрипты для foo_uie_wsh_panel_mod

Список разделов Аудиоплеер foobar2000 Секреты foobar2000

Описание: Кнопочки, конфиги, секреты, советы.

Сообщение #2781 SergPuh.68 » 01.01.2021, 17:12

С Новым Годом!!! :beer:
YouTube Music
SergPuh.68 M
Аватара
Откуда: Украина
Репутация: 120
С нами: 2 года 8 месяцев

Сообщение #2782 softvip » 08.01.2021, 20:37

Вопрос а картинки Артистов и Альбомов у всех не грузятся? Если это так, то когда примерно починят?
softvip
Репутация: 1
С нами: 3 года 1 месяц

Сообщение #2783 vladj » 08.01.2021, 23:37

softvip:картинки Артистов и Альбомов у всех не грузятся?
Смотря на чём... в панели на скрипте био @author "kgena_ua" всё работает, грузятся и картинки и био.
HTPC Termaltake, eGlobal i5-7200, Asrock Beebox J3160, Onkyo 525E, цап SMSL, фронт Yamaha 8900.
vladj M
Аватара
Откуда: Пермский край
Репутация: 422
С нами: 11 лет 7 месяцев

Сообщение #2784 softvip » 09.01.2021, 18:13

vladj, странно у меня не грузит ни чего, а какая версия у вас?
softvip
Репутация: 1
С нами: 3 года 1 месяц

Сообщение #2785 vladj » 09.01.2021, 18:30

Версия не очень свежая, модифицированная чуток с сайта PCCar. Отличие от стоковых в том, что для просмотра био тычок и био полностью на панели, тычок по названию и снова внизу только название. Точно версию посмотреть не могу, сижу в linux, а в нём скрипты некоторые не работают, да и не нужно гадить тут на ssd картинками лишний раз. В винде у меня фубар на рам диске, можно по 20 картинок качать-смотреть, всё в оперативе крутится. Хотя что это я... ну не работает скрипт, а в настройках ведь можно посмотреть, туплю... :smile:
// @name "Biography, Albums, Similar and title artist info. www.last.fm"
// @version "030322018"
// @author "kgena_ua"
// @touch-mod v3 "seriousstas"
HTPC Termaltake, eGlobal i5-7200, Asrock Beebox J3160, Onkyo 525E, цап SMSL, фронт Yamaha 8900.
vladj M
Аватара
Откуда: Пермский край
Репутация: 422
С нами: 11 лет 7 месяцев

Сообщение #2786 softvip » 26.01.2021, 20:41

Код: Выделить всё
YouTube Track Manager: youtube N/A: {
  "error": {
    "code": 403,
    "message": "The request cannot be completed because you have exceeded your \u003ca href=\"/youtube/v3/getting-started#quota\"\u003equota\u003c/a\u003e.",
    "errors": [
      {
        "message": "The request cannot be completed because you have exceeded your \u003ca href=\"/youtube/v3/getting-started#quota\"\u003equota\u003c/a\u003e.",
        "domain": "youtube.quota",
        "reason": "quotaExceeded"
      }
    ]
  }
}
что это значит?
softvip
Репутация: 1
С нами: 3 года 1 месяц

Сообщение #2787 SergPuh.68 » 26.01.2021, 21:26

softvip, скрипт YouTube Track Manager сообщает что превышен лимит запросов.Как я понимаю в полночь счётчик будет сброшен и всё заработает.Но вам необходимо применить ограничение ключа API.
2021-01-26_192854.png
YouTube Music
SergPuh.68 M
Аватара
Откуда: Украина
Репутация: 120
С нами: 2 года 8 месяцев

Сообщение #2788 softvip » 27.01.2021, 23:22

SergPuh.68, тоже самое, может ещё один ключ создать только для этого скрипта так как у меня этот ключ задействован в плагине Youtube?
softvip
Репутация: 1
С нами: 3 года 1 месяц

Сообщение #2789 SergPuh.68 » 27.01.2021, 23:34

softvip, я так не пробовал с двумя ключами но на 99% уверен что проект крякнет.Я в таких случаях удаляю проект и создаю новый с новым ключом,обычно всё начинает работать,только нужно написать в службу поддержки и увеличить количество проектов,я попросил 50,на следующий день увеличили до 50. У меня один ключ и туда и туда.
YouTube Music
SergPuh.68 M
Аватара
Откуда: Украина
Репутация: 120
С нами: 2 года 8 месяцев

Сообщение #2790 softvip » 28.01.2021, 01:40

SergPuh.68, спасибо сделал новый проект и всё заработало!
softvip
Репутация: 1
С нами: 3 года 1 месяц

Сообщение #2791 softvip » 03.02.2021, 18:00

Почему когда в первый раз за день включаю foobar2000 появляется такая ошибка
Код: Выделить всё
Error: Spider Monkey Panel v1.3.1 (YouTube Track Manager v4.1.3 by WilB)
cur_handle is null

File: <main>
Line: 3415, Column: 55

Stack trace:
  Images/this.get_album_art_done@<main>:3415:55
  on_get_album_art_done@<main>:3752:72
конечно если обновить скрипт, то подгрузится, но просто каждый день так, может это из-за того что у меня в папке foobar есть profile и там всё находится?
softvip
Репутация: 1
С нами: 3 года 1 месяц

Сообщение #2792 SergPuh.68 » 04.02.2021, 10:19

softvip, сбросьте настройки YouTube Track Manager v4.1.3 by WilB по умолчанию нажав на кнопку Clear,если не поможет поставьте предыдущую версию скрипта 4.1.2 и понаблюдайте.Вставьте ключ.
YouTube Music
SergPuh.68 M
Аватара
Откуда: Украина
Репутация: 120
С нами: 2 года 8 месяцев

Сообщение #2793 SergPuh.68 » 08.02.2021, 11:00

Привет.Попробовал адаптировать под себя скрипт:
Код: Выделить всё
var g_btn_img1 = gdi.Image(fb.FoobarPath + "images/111.png");
var g_btn_img2 = gdi.Image(fb.FoobarPath + "images/222.png");
var g_btn_now = g_btn_img1;
var tooltip = window.CreateTooltip();
var old_x = -1;
PlaybackOrderId = {
   0:"По умолчанию",
   1:"Повторение (плейлист)",
   2:"Повторение (трек)",
   3:"Случайный трек",
   4:"Перемешивание (треки)",
   5:"Перемешивание (альбомы)",
   6:"Перемешивание (папки)"
};

function on_paint(gr){
   gr.DrawImage(g_btn_now, 0, 0, window.Width, window.Height, 0, 0, 24, 24);
}
function on_mouse_move(x,y){
   g_btn_now = g_btn_img2;
   window.Repaint();
   if(x!=old_x){
      old_x=x;
      tooltip.Text =  'Порядок воспроизведения: ' + PlaybackOrderId[fb.PlaybackOrder];
      tooltip.Activate();
   }
}
function on_mouse_leave(){
   g_btn_now = g_btn_img1;
   window.Repaint();
   tooltip.Deactivate();
}
function on_mouse_lbtn_down(x, y){
   var _menu = window.CreatePopupMenu();
   for (i=1; i<=7; i++) _menu.AppendMenuItem(0x00000000, i, PlaybackOrderId[i-1]);
   _menu.CheckMenuRadioItem(7, 1, fb.PlaybackOrder+1);
   var ret = _menu.TrackPopupMenu(x, y);
   if (ret>=1 && ret<=7) fb.PlaybackOrder = ret-1;
   _menu.Dispose();
}
//EOF
Но что то пошло не так:
2021-02-08_085320.jpg

Может кто укажет на ошибку?
YouTube Music
SergPuh.68 M
Аватара
Откуда: Украина
Репутация: 120
С нами: 2 года 8 месяцев

Сообщение #2794 kgena_ua » 08.02.2021, 20:51

SergPuh.68,
для jscript_panel

Код: Выделить всё
      tooltip.Text =  'Порядок воспроизведения: ' + PlaybackOrderId[plman.PlaybackOrder];

Код: Выделить всё
function on_mouse_lbtn_down(x, y){
   var _menu = window.CreatePopupMenu();
   for (i = 0; i < 7; i++) _menu.AppendMenuItem(0x00000000, i, PlaybackOrderId[i]);
   _menu.CheckMenuRadioItem(0, 6, plman.PlaybackOrder);
   var ret = _menu.TrackPopupMenu(x, y);
   plman.PlaybackOrder = ret
   _menu.Dispose();
}
I.m.UR5EQF.
квартет на миллион долларов
kgena_ua M
Аватара
Возраст: 57
Откуда: Украина, Днепр
Репутация: 493
С нами: 8 лет 5 месяцев

Сообщение #2795 MC Web » 08.02.2021, 21:16

kgena_ua, приветствую.
Раз уж заглянул, может посмотришь и проблему при использовании плейлистов с m-TAGS не работает скрипт биографии (ЗДЕСЬ).
MC Web
Репутация: 240
С нами: 8 лет

Сообщение #2796 kgena_ua » 08.02.2021, 21:22

MC Web, привет.
Да я слежу за форумом постоянно.
Совсем не знаком с m-TAGS. Пытался скачать плагин - не нашел. Нужно воспроизвести "ошибку", не знаю как.
I.m.UR5EQF.
квартет на миллион долларов
kgena_ua M
Аватара
Возраст: 57
Откуда: Украина, Днепр
Репутация: 493
С нами: 8 лет 5 месяцев

Сообщение #2797 SergPuh.68 » 08.02.2021, 21:27

kgena_ua, спасибо скрипт заработал только почему то после изменения размеров окна плеера пропадает иконка
Порядок воспроизведения (на русском):
Спойлер
Код: Выделить всё
var g_btn_img1 = gdi.Image(fb.FoobarPath + "images/111.png");
var g_btn_img2 = gdi.Image(fb.FoobarPath + "images/222.png");
var g_btn_now = g_btn_img1;
var tooltip = window.CreateTooltip();
var old_x = -1;
PlaybackOrderId = {
   0:"По умолчанию",
   1:"Повторение (плейлист)",
   2:"Повторение (трек)",
   3:"Случайный трек",
   4:"Перемешивание (треки)",
   5:"Перемешивание (альбомы)",
   6:"Перемешивание (папки)"
};

function on_paint(gr){
   gr.DrawImage(g_btn_now, 0, 0, window.Width, window.Height, 0, 0, 24, 24);
}
function on_mouse_move(x,y){
   g_btn_now = g_btn_img2;
   window.Repaint();
   if(x!=old_x){
      old_x=x;
      tooltip.Text =  'Порядок воспроизведения: ' + PlaybackOrderId[plman.PlaybackOrder];
      tooltip.Activate();
   }
}
function on_mouse_leave(){
   g_btn_now = g_btn_img1;
   window.Repaint();
   tooltip.Deactivate();
}
function on_mouse_lbtn_down(x, y){
   var _menu = window.CreatePopupMenu();
   for (i = 0; i < 7; i++) _menu.AppendMenuItem(0x00000000, i, PlaybackOrderId[i]);
   _menu.CheckMenuRadioItem(0, 6, plman.PlaybackOrder);
   var ret = _menu.TrackPopupMenu(x, y);
   plman.PlaybackOrder = ret
   _menu.Dispose();
}
//EOF
YouTube Music
SergPuh.68 M
Аватара
Откуда: Украина
Репутация: 120
С нами: 2 года 8 месяцев

Сообщение #2798 kgena_ua » 08.02.2021, 21:31

SergPuh.68:после изменения размеров окна плеера пропадает иконка
С иконкой я не разбирался.
I.m.UR5EQF.
квартет на миллион долларов
kgena_ua M
Аватара
Возраст: 57
Откуда: Украина, Днепр
Репутация: 493
С нами: 8 лет 5 месяцев

Сообщение #2799 MC Web » 08.02.2021, 21:32

kgena_ua, так ты сборку FooBAZ (RU) скачай, там он (foo_tags) есть. Заодно все что нужно для проверки данной проблемы есть в комплекте, включая твой скрипт.
MC Web
Репутация: 240
С нами: 8 лет

Сообщение #2800 kgena_ua » 08.02.2021, 21:35

MC Web:так ты сборку FooBAZ (RU) скачай
Будем смотреть.
Спасибо. Если будут вопросы, задам.
I.m.UR5EQF.
квартет на миллион долларов
kgena_ua M
Аватара
Возраст: 57
Откуда: Украина, Днепр
Репутация: 493
С нами: 8 лет 5 месяцев

Пред.След.

Вернуться в Секреты foobar2000